What is node-resolve-pkg

node-resolve-pkg is:

Some packages like CLI tools and grunt tasks don’t have a entry point, like "main": "foo.js" in package.json, resulting in them not being resolvable by require.resolve(). Unlike require.resolve(), this module also resolves packages without an entry point, returns null instead of throwing when the module can’t be found, and resolves from process.cwd() instead __dirname by default.

Install node-resolve-pkg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install node-resolve-pkg using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install node-resolve-pkg
